Podmores have secured an order of 24 vibratory bowl feeders from a leading packaging systems company based in the Netherlands. The 24 low-frequency vibratory bowl feeders will be integrated into a high-speed crisp packet counting and packaging line, that is capable of processing an amazing 750 million bags of crisps per year. Each bowl feeder will receive a bulk supply of product from a storage conveyor and will sort over 120 bags per minute, providing a steady and controlled out-feed of individual bags to a conveyor system that incorporates counting devices that allow specific batches of bags to be counted into boxes or containers below.

Podmores has been supplying equipment to Cannon Plastics, a company established in 1973 and a specialist in screen printing plastic bottles, aerosol caps, metal anodised cosmetic components and injection moulded closures, for over 20 years. The first item installed was a bowl feeder that is still in daily use some 19 years later and the latest addition to their production line is a Podmores bottle un-scrambler that feeds bottles to their main four color printer. The new Podmores equipment added to their production line was strategically bought to enable Cannon to fulfill long term contracts that the company has recently acquired with large blue chip companies.
